Idegahama Beach, located in Tottori, Japan, is a picturesque coastal gem that stretches over a length of approximately 2 kilometers. The beach is renowned for its pristine sandy shores, boasting soft, golden sand that contrasts beautifully with the azure waters of the Sea of Japan.